1. Recognising Links Between Subjects | 识别学科之间的联系
Interdisciplinary questions often use a biological scenario but ask you to draw on ideas from other subjects. For example, a question about leaf structure might ask why stomata open and close – this involves diffusion, osmosis and guard cell chemistry. The first step is to underline the key science words and identify which part of the question is pure biology and which part relies on another discipline.

2. Diffusion and Osmosis: Merging Biology and Chemistry | 扩散与渗透:生物与化学融合
Diffusion and osmosis are classic areas where biology meets chemistry. In KS3, you learn that particles move from a region of higher concentration to a region of lower concentration. Exam questions often link this to cell membranes, lung gas exchange or root hair cells. You need to describe not just the process but also the kinetic particle theory ideas from chemistry.

Worked example: ‘Explain why oxygen moves from the alveoli into the blood.’ (3 marks) Your answer should mention that there is a higher concentration of oxygen in the alveoli than in the blood, so oxygen particles move down the concentration gradient by diffusion. Use chemical ideas about random particle movement.

Osmosis is a special case of diffusion involving water across a partially permeable membrane. Interdisciplinary questions might ask you to calculate percentage change in mass, blending maths with biology. Always link water potential to the direction of net water movement.

3. Photosynthesis: A Chemical Reaction in Living Systems | 光合作用:生命系统中的化学反应
Photosynthesis is a biological process that is fundamentally a chemical reaction. The word equation is simple: carbon dioxide + water → glucose + oxygen, in the presence of light and chlorophyll. Yet interdisciplinary questions push you to balance ideas about energy transformation, reaction rates and limiting factors.

You may be given a graph showing how light intensity affects the rate of photosynthesis and asked to explain the shape using collision theory from chemistry. The rate increases as more light provides energy for the reaction, until another factor (like carbon dioxide) becomes limiting.

4. Respiration and Energy Transfers | 呼吸作用与能量传递
Aerobic respiration is another chemical reaction: glucose + oxygen → carbon dioxide + water, releasing energy. Interdisciplinary questions often combine this with energy concepts from physics. You might be asked to explain why muscles generate heat during exercise or how respiration provides energy for movement and growth – linking biology to kinetic and thermal energy.

Exam tip: when describing respiration as an exothermic reaction, use the term ‘release’ of energy. Show understanding that energy is not created but transferred. A typical 4-mark question could ask you to compare respiration and combustion, noting that both use oxygen and release energy, but respiration is controlled by enzymes in living cells.

Such comparisons require chemical literacy: you need to recall that combustion is a rapid reaction with oxygen producing heat and light, while respiration is a slow, enzyme-controlled process occurring at body temperature. This is a perfect interdisciplinary checkpoint.

5. Enzymes: Biological Catalysts and Reaction Rates | 酶:生物催化剂与反应速率
Enzymes are proteins that speed up chemical reactions. Questions frequently ask about the effect of temperature and pH on enzyme activity, pulling in concepts from chemistry about denaturation and collision frequency. An interdisciplinary question might present a table of enzyme activity at different pH levels and ask you to deduce the optimum pH, explaining why activity falls at extremes.

You should describe denaturation as a permanent change to the active site’s shape, preventing substrate binding. Use the lock-and-key model as a biological analogy, but back it up with the idea that bonds holding the protein shape break under unsuitable conditions – this is chemistry.

Data interpretation tasks often involve plotting line graphs with temperature on the x-axis (a continuous physical variable) and reaction rate on the y-axis. You must be able to explain the initial rise (more kinetic energy, more successful collisions) and the subsequent fall (enzyme denatures). This uses both physics and chemistry language.

6. Food Chains, Kilojoules and Energy Pyramids | 食物链、千焦与能量金字塔
When you study feeding relationships, you soon meet the concept of energy transfer. KS3 biology expects you to interpret food chains and pyramids of numbers. However, interdisciplinary exam tasks may give you data on energy content (in kJ) at each trophic level and ask you to calculate the percentage of energy transferred – blending biology with mathematics.

Sample analysis: a food chain has grass (5000 kJ) → rabbit (500 kJ) → fox (50 kJ). Calculate the energy transfer efficiency between rabbit and fox. You need to identify that only about 10% of energy passes from one level to the next. This can lead to a discussion of energy loss as heat and movement – linking back to physics.

7. The Human Body: Pressure, Force and Mechanics | 人体:压强、力与力学
The circulatory system offers rich opportunities for physics integration. Questions about blood pressure often ask you to explain why arteries have thick muscular walls while veins have valves. Here biology describes the structure, but physics explains the function – high pressure from the heart requires strength, and valves prevent backflow caused by low pressure and gravity.

Breathing mechanics is another cross-boundary topic. When you inhale, the diaphragm contracts and the ribcage moves up and out. This increases the volume of the chest, decreasing the pressure inside the lungs so air rushes in – an application of gas pressure and Boyle’s law, even if not named at KS3. You should describe the pressure difference without necessarily naming the law, but understand the principle.

8. Microscopy and Physics of Light | 显微镜与光物理
Using a microscope is a fundamental practical skill. Interdisciplinary questions might explore how light passes through the specimen, or how magnification is calculated. The formula magnification = eyepiece lens magnification × objective lens magnification is straightforward, but you might also be asked to calculate the actual size of a cell using the magnification and the measured image size – applying ratio and proportion.

In addition, considering how resolution is limited by the wavelength of light links to physics. While not always tested in depth, you could be given information that electron microscopes have higher resolution because they use electrons with a much shorter wavelength. This invites you to compare light physics with biological imaging.

A typical integrated task: ‘A student measures the diameter of a cell image as 60 mm when viewed at ×400. Calculate the real diameter of the cell in micrometres.’ (1 mm = 1000 µm). You need to convert units and divide, showing comfort with maths.

9. Carbon Cycle and Geography | 碳循环与地理
The carbon cycle is a biology topic with strong links to geography and environmental science. Exam questions can ask you to describe how carbon moves through photosynthesis, respiration, combustion and decomposition, and then relate this to atmospheric CO₂ levels and climate change – a geography concept. You must be able to interpret diagrams showing carbon reservoirs and fluxes, often with arrows and labels.

Interdisciplinary writing tasks might ask you to explain why deforestation increases atmospheric carbon dioxide, linking biology (trees remove CO₂) to climate impacts. Use scientific vocabulary such as “carbon sink” and “greenhouse effect”, and sequence events logically.

10. Designing Experiments with Multiple Variables | 设计多变量实验
KS3 investigations often require you to identify independent, dependent and control variables. An interdisciplinary twist occurs when the control variable involves a measurement from physics or chemistry, such as controlling temperature with a water bath, or maintaining a constant carbon dioxide concentration using a chemical solution. You need to explain why these controls are essential for valid results.

For instance, in a photosynthesis experiment using pondweed, you might control light intensity by moving a lamp (physics) and add sodium hydrogencarbonate to supply CO₂ (chemistry). Questions can probe your understanding of how changing these conditions alters the rate of bubbling (oxygen production).

Another typical experiment investigates enzyme activity using starch and amylase. You control pH using buffer solutions (chemistry), temperature with a water bath (physics), and time with a stopwatch. Integrating these elements in your planning and evaluation demonstrates robust cross-curricular thinking.

11. Graph Skills and Interpreting Trends | 图表技能与趋势解读
Many interdisciplinary questions are built around a graph. You may be asked to describe the relationship between two variables, calculate a rate from the slope, or predict values beyond the given data. These skills come from mathematics but are examined within biology contexts such as enzyme activity, population growth, or photosynthesis.

When a graph shows a curve that levels off, link the plateau to a limiting factor in biology. Use the term “directly proportional” only if the line is straight through the origin. Practice drawing lines of best fit and spotting anomalous points, as these are common requirements.

12. Strategies for Revision and Exam Success | 复习策略与应试成功
Build a personal glossary of interdisciplinary terms. For each key word – like concentration, energy, rate, pressure, or pH – write down both the biology meaning and the way it is used in the linked subject. This helps you switch contexts quickly during an exam.

Practise with past paper questions that have multiple parts. When you see a question split into (a), (b) and (c), check whether part (a) is pure biology, (b) leans on chemistry and (c) brings in maths. This pattern is common. Use mark schemes to learn how to phrase answers that bridge subjects.

Finally, when revising, draw concept maps that connect biology topics to other subjects. For example, around ‘Respiration’ write bubbles for ‘energy (physics)’, ‘exothermic reaction (chemistry)’, and ‘biomass (ecology)’. This visual exercise trains your brain to make links automatically, building the integrated thinking needed for top marks.
